DTMB标准BCH译码器设计

发布时间:2012-2-23 15:34    发布者:李宽
关键词: BCH , DTMB , 译码
作者:许苑丰,王鹏

摘要:BCH码是目前最为常用的纠错码之一,我国的数字电视广播地面传输标准DTMB也使用了缩短的BCH码作为前向纠错编码的外码。针对该BCH码的特点,采用BM译码算法,设计了一种实时译码器。与其它设计方案相比较,显著减少了占用逻辑数量。整个设计在Stratix II FPGA上进行了综合验证,满足了设计要求。

引言

BCH码构成了一大类强有力的纠正随机错误的循环码,它是对汉明码的一种重要推广,可用于纠正多个错误,Bose、Chaudhuri和Hocquenghem最初提出了二进制BCH码,此后Peterson在1960年证明了BCH码的循环结构。对于任何正整数m(m≥3)和t(t≥2),存在如下形式的BCH码:

分组长度:n=2m-l;校验位数目:n-k≤mt;最小距离:dmin≥2t+1。

该码能够纠正t个或少于t个差错的任意组合。其生成多项式由它在伽罗华域GF(2m)上的根确定。这样得到的BCH码通常被称作本原或狭义BCH码。而码长n≠2m-l的二进制BCH码可以采用与上述本原BCH码相似的方法构造,它的最小距离至少为2t+1,同样可以纠正至t多个错误。

由于BCH码性能优良,结构简单,编译码设备也不太复杂,使得它在实际使用中特别受到工程技术人员的欢迎,是目前用得最广泛的码类之一。

下载全文:
DTMB标准BCH译码器设计.pdf (3.65 MB)
本文地址:https://www.eechina.com/thread-86380-1-1.html     【打印本页】

本站部分文章为转载或网友发布,目的在于传递和分享信息,并不代表本网赞同其观点和对其真实性负责;文章版权归原作者及原出处所有,如涉及作品内容、版权和其它问题,我们将根据著作权人的要求,第一时间更正或删除。
您需要登录后才可以发表评论 登录 | 立即注册

厂商推荐

关于我们  -  服务条款  -  使用指南  -  站点地图  -  友情链接  -  联系我们
电子工程网 © 版权所有   京ICP备16069177号 | 京公网安备11010502021702
快速回复 返回顶部 返回列表